Government Publishes Construction Products Reform Documents: Responding to Grenfell Calls

The UK government released key documents on construction products reform at the end of February 2026. This comprehensive package, including White Papers and consultations, directly addresses Grenfell Tower Inquiry's concerns over oversight and product integrity, promising stricter enforcement and new criminal sanctions.. Overhauling Construction Product Regulations At the close of February 2026, the UK government published a series of pivotal documents outlining its strategy for construction products reform. This extensive package, reported by BCLP via JDSupra, includes the Construction Products Reform Green Paper summary, a White Paper, and a consultation on the General Safety Requirement (GSR). These reforms are a direct response to the Grenfell Tower Inquiry's profound concerns regarding inadequate oversight, conflicts of interest in certification bodies, and gaps in product testing. Stricter Controls and Enhanced Enforcement The proposed reforms signal a significant shift towards stricter controls and enhanced enforcement within the construction industry. Key proposals include the introduction of new criminal offenses, unlimited fines, imprisonment, and director disqualification for non compliance. This tiered approach aims to ensure greater accountability and product integrity, aligning UK regulations with EU product standards while replacing existing 2011/2013 frameworks.
